Modern and Contemporary Literature Research seminars: Prof Marina Warner in conversation with Dr Karolina Watroba (All Souls) about her book Inventory of A Life Mislaid: An Unreliable Memoir (2021) and on life-writing more generally
Professor Dame Marina Warner in conversation with Dr Karolina Watroba about her memoir Inventory of a Life Mislaid: An Unreliable Memoir (2021) and on life-writing. Chaired by Prof Santanu Das.
